SU Awards Evening – Thursday 2nd May
On Thursday 2nd May 2013 we are hosting an Awards Evening whereby students and staff are recognised for their hard work, dedication and making a difference.
This is your chance to nominate an individual who has gone that extra mile.
There are many areas in which students and staff can be nominated such as Volunteering, Sports or the Shaping my Future Award. Click on the link below for more information on the different award categories and nominate an individual to give them a chance to get the recognition they deserve.
The awards evening will take place on Thursday 2nd May 2013 in the Engine Shed, tickets will be issued by invitation only to the top nominees in each category and their guests.
Union Awards (Awards for Students)
 |
The Volunteering Award
For students who have shown outstanding commitment to Volunteering. Perhaps you know someone who has committed significant time and effort to a project in the community or in the University, or someone who has initiated a new project or helped to develop an existing project. A student involved in volunteering who has gone above and beyond to make a significant difference. |
 |
The Media Award
For students who have volunteered for the SU Media Team, who have shown outstanding commitment. Perhaps you know a member of this team who has committed significant time and effort to the development of one of the brands (online, tv, magazine) or who has worked to involve more students with the group, or has demonstrated skill or innovation or commitment in some other way. |
 |
The Representation Award
For students who have shown outstanding commitment in representing the views of others. This award is for a student who has been an ambassador for students on their course or in their school or faculty. Perhaps you know a Student Rep who works tirelessly to involve students or build good communication with their course team or pursue change that benefits others. |
 |
The Sports Award
For students who have shown outstanding commitment to Sports within the Students' Union. A team player or individual performer who has demonstrated excellent skill or committed significant time and effort to the development of themselves or others. Perhaps someone who has worked to improve things for all students who play sports or to involve more students in SU sports. |
 |
The Societies Award
For students who have shown outstanding commitment to Societies within the Students' Union. An innovator or an involver, someone who has dedicated significant time and effort to the development Society/ies .Perhaps someone who has worked to bring Societies together, improve things for Societies, or involve more students in Societies. |
 |
The Roger Buttery Union Award (Students)
An award for students who have shown outstanding commitment in any area of work with the Students' Union. This award is for a student who has developed or innovated or communicated or involved in some way that does not fall within the categories above. An opportunity to nominate an unsung hero of the SU. |
Teaching Awards (Awards for Staff)
 |
Inspiring Teaching Award
Awarded to a member of teaching staff whose teaching whether it is through style or content has inspired students to go beyond in the community, continue learning with postgraduate study or to achieve outstandingly in academic assessment. As part of their transformative impact on their student(s) the student as producer agenda should have been prominent in their work and an example should be given in the nomination. |
 |
Professional Services Team Award
Awarded to the University’s professional services team that are constantly enhancing the student experience or offering a great standard of service. These teams can include; ICT, Library, Careers Service, Advice Service, Catering, etc. |
 |
Love My Feedback Award
You tell us and the NSS you want better feedback; feedback that is clear and personalised so we want you to give us examples from this year of feedback that has been just that. Tell us how you have been able to use this good feedback to improve your next essay or exam. |
 |
The Union Award (Staff)
The outstanding achievement award for an individual member of staff who has consistently and passionately worked to enhance the experience of students, either over a longer period of time or during the year one a particular significant project. The member of staff can be a teacher, administrator or service provider as long as this person has positively impacted on the lives of others. |
 |
Postgraduate's Choice Award
The University wants to grow the number of the postgraduate students studying here so we’re asking you the current students to tell us what the strengths of the offering we already have are so that we can build on those aspects and continue to improve the postgraduate experience as well as improve access. The winner of this award can either be a supervisor, administrator or member of a support service who makes a positive impact on the learners life. |
 |
Shaping My Future Award
This award is for either an individual staff member or a specific course team who have employability on their agenda and are going the extra mile to offer careers advice/ expertise and ensure you are more confident about your skills as you look to go beyond university. |
 |
Best Course Award
Taking into account the teaching quality, feedback and organisation of the course i.e timetable, deadlines and administrative support what has been your favourite course? Let us know what is so special about it and why has it inspired you to nominate it. Keep in mind that you should highlight things this course does which others could take on board to improve their offering. |
